MAY 7, 2009 -- Telecom Engineering USA Inc. (search Lightwave for Telecom Engineering USA) has announced its new multifunction DWDM Lite 10G Transponder.

The DWDM Lite 10G Transponder is a standalone tunable transponder and repeater that converts any 10-Gbps wavelength to any C-band DWDM channel or selected CWDM channels for metro or long-haul transmission.

Applications include:


  • 10-Gbps DWDM and CWDM metro or long-haul networks
  • 200-, 100-, and 50-GHz channel DWDM multiplexers
  • 3R repeater functionality fully reconditions the signal, allowing for long-distance transmission
  • hot or cold standby, channel tunable, DWDM transceiver spare.
Standard features and options include:

  • completely standalone 10G transponder; no other equipment required
  • fully compatible and transparent to existing protocols including OC-192, STM-64, 10GbE, OTN G.709 FEC, and 10G Fibre Channel
  • tunable over C-band or L-band DWDM channels
  • repeater 3R regeneration that extends 10G SONET/SDH and Ethernet transmission distances
  • cold or hot standby spare functionality used to spare existing or new DWDM 10G transceivers
  • OTN G.709 Forward Error Correction (FEC) available for SONET/SDH and 10GbE traffic
  • optical power budget of 36 dB or 47 dB with FEC
  • long transmission span capability of up to 200 km (125 miles) over standard fiber (G.652)
  • built-in optical booster and preamplifier
  • built-in dispersion compensation
  • 1+1 protection switching (OUPSR), diverse route or equipment
  • laser polarization control available to help reduce nonlinear distortions (FWM) interference
  • A & B -48 Vdc power input or 120/240 Vac power
  • simple Web browser Ethernet access for remote or local monitoring and control
  • critical, major, and minor alarms and dry alarm contacts
  • built-in audible alarm and alarm acknowledgement
  • alarm history available through GUI interface
  • power-saving "green" selectable on/off control for cold standby spare operation
  • easy installation and setup; no programming or special skills required
  • 1-rmu height (1.75 inch), 19- and 23-inch rack mounting
  • 3-year warranty
  • low price.
